Fuel Pressure Sensor: Removal: Removal
- PRECAUTION WARNING:
- Do not smoke or work near an open flame when handling the fuel system.
- Keep gasoline away from rubber or leather parts.
- Do not allow fuel to spray when removing the pipe between the high pressure side fuel pump assembly and the fuel injector assembly. The fuel in the pipe is highly pressurized.
- DISCHARGE FUEL SYSTEM PRESSURE
- Discharge fuel system pressure. Refer to PRECAUTION .
- DISCONNECT CABLE FROM N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L NOTE:
When disconnecting the cable, some systems need to be initialized after the cable is reconnected. Refer to INITIALIZATION .
- REMOVE INTAKE AIR SURGE TANK ASSEMBLY
- Remove the intake air surge tank assembly. Refer to REMOVAL .
- REMOVE NO. 1 ENGINE COVER SUB-ASSEMBLY See step 11
- REMOVE FUEL PRESSURE SENSOR
- Disconnect the connector.
- Remove the fuel pressure sensor and gasket.
